Facing Imposter Syndrome in Sobriety: Dion Miller's Honest Journey
Episode Overview
- Imposter syndrome can make you question your sobriety.
- Success can feel as daunting as failure in recovery.
- Survivor's guilt is common among those who thrive in sobriety.
- Self-sabotage often arises from unfamiliar success.
- Feeling 'sober enough' is a personal journey.
